Code Number: 5K40.49b
Demo Title: Space Circles - Space Balls
Condition: Excellent
Principle: Motors, Elec. & Mag.
Area of Study: Perpetual Motion
Equipment:
Space Circles Demo, Space Balls Demo, Fresh 9 volt Batteries.
Procedure:
See also: 5K40.49b in Perpetual Motion.
These demos are specially designed brushless DC electric motors. The moving parts have magnets in them and correspond to the rotor and flywheel of the motor. The base of the demo contains a battery, coil, steel core, and a transistor. The moving rotor induces an electric current in the coil. This current is amplified and fed into an electromagnet which applies a torque to the magnetic rotor.
